7+ Best Bible Studies Books of the Bible Guides

Engaging with scriptural texts involves examining individual books within the biblical canon. This approach often entails close reading, analysis of historical context, exploration of literary genres, and consideration of theological implications. For example, a study of the Book of Genesis might explore creation narratives, patriarchal history, and the covenant with Abraham, while a study of the Gospel of John might focus on Christology, miracles, and the concept of eternal life.

A deep understanding of individual books is crucial for a holistic grasp of the overarching biblical narrative. It allows for nuanced interpretation, avoids proof-texting, and fosters appreciation for the diverse literary and theological traditions within the Bible. Historically, focusing on specific books has been a cornerstone of theological education and spiritual formation, enabling communities of faith to engage with scripture meaningfully throughout centuries. Such concentrated study provides a foundation for interpreting scripture within its historical and literary context, leading to a richer understanding of its message.

8+ Best Social Studies Books for 5th Graders (2024)

Fifth-grade level texts covering history, civics, geography, and culture provide young learners with foundational knowledge about the world around them. These resources typically integrate age-appropriate language, engaging visuals, and interactive elements to facilitate comprehension and critical thinking. Examples might include biographies of historical figures, illustrated maps depicting various societies, or narratives exploring different cultural practices.

Exposure to these educational materials cultivates a deeper understanding of societal structures, historical events, and diverse perspectives. This understanding promotes civic engagement, critical thinking skills, and a greater appreciation for different cultures. Historically, such educational resources have evolved, reflecting changing societal values and pedagogical approaches. By fostering these skills, these resources empower students to become informed and responsible citizens.

7th Grade Social Studies ABC Book: A-Z Guide

An alphabetical arrangement of topics related to a seventh-grade social studies curriculum, often illustrated, serves as an engaging learning tool. Imagine a student creating an entry for “C” with “Civilization” as the term, providing a definition and an image of an ancient city. This approach encourages creativity and deeper understanding of key concepts. Such projects offer various formats, from handwritten booklets to digital presentations.

This pedagogical approach fosters active learning by encouraging students to synthesize information, make connections between concepts, and express their understanding visually and textually. It caters to diverse learning styles and can be adapted to explore specific historical periods, geographical regions, or cultural themes. Historically, alphabetical arrangements have been valuable tools for organizing and accessing information, making this project format a natural fit for educational purposes. It provides a framework for students to build a comprehensive overview of their social studies curriculum.

8+ Cross-Dressing Yaoi Manga: Fantasy Book Studies

This area of study explores the intersection of gender expression, sexuality, and popular culture within Japanese comics and their related media. It delves into artistic representations of non-normative gender presentation, often involving male characters in feminine attire, within specific genres like romantic or erotic narratives targeted towards a female audience. Academic investigations may analyze the cultural significance, psychological implications, and evolving social contexts surrounding these portrayals.

Examination of these themes provides valuable insights into societal perceptions of masculinity, femininity, and desire. It can illuminate how media reflects and shapes cultural understandings of gender identity and sexual expression. Furthermore, this field of study can contribute to broader discussions surrounding representation, identity politics, and the power dynamics inherent in popular culture. By analyzing historical trends and contemporary examples, researchers can gain a deeper understanding of the evolution of these portrayals and their influence on audiences.
